This stability, the body's normal state, is named homeostasis. When the physique stays in an excited state for a prolonged period, it enters the final state of Selye's general adaptation syndrome -- the state of exhaustion (SE). This stage occurs when response to a stressor has gone on too long. On this state of hyperarousal, the body's immune system begins to put on down. Because of this, an individual shall be extra inclined to infections and different illnesses as the body's defenses have been spent on dealing with a stressor. An individual in a prolonged state of stress might easily catch a cold or have an elevated likelihood of suffering a coronary heart assault. The state of exhaustion stage is seen most steadily in instances of extended stress, similar to office stress. So in the end it's a very good thing your body's objective is homeostasis. The regulation of gluconeogenesis, like that of glycolysis, primarily targets the enzymes which are distinctive to every pathway, slightly than these which are shared between them. In glycolysis, the major regulatory control points are the reactions catalyzed by PFK-1 and pyruvate kinase. In contrast, gluconeogenesis is mainly regulated at the steps catalyzed by fructose 1,6-bisphosphatase and pyruvate carboxylase. The other two enzymes unique to gluconeogenesis, glucose 6-phosphatase and Healthy Flow Blood natural support phosphoenolpyruvate carboxykinase, are regulated primarily on the transcriptional degree, in response to hormonal and metabolic indicators. The fate of pyruvate depends largely on the availability of acetyl-CoA, which in flip displays the supply of fatty acids within the mitochondrion. When fatty acids are considerable, their β-oxidation generates acetyl-CoA, which enters the citric acid cycle and Healthy Flow Blood produces GTP and NADH. This elevated ratio inhibits the citric acid cycle, causing acetyl-CoA to accumulate within the mitochondrial matrix. Thus, when the cellular power charge is high, the conversion of pyruvate to acetyl-CoA slows down, while its conversion to oxaloacetate, and finally glucose, is promoted.

These had been some of the world's prime athletes, who can constantly run the 4:34.5 per mile pace that's required. A bunch of seven pacemakers have been in front of Kipchoge in a V formation. Kipchoge was placed at the bottom of the formation with two pacemakers working behind him. During the run the pacemakers labored in groups to rotate in and out of the race throughout each of the 9.6km laps of the course. They modified positions at the finish line on every lap. In entrance of the pacemakers had been a series of cars. The one immediately in entrance of the runners was a tempo car displaying projected end occasions and carrying a laser system that initiatives where the pacemakers ought to run. Crucially, it acted as a big barrier that can cut back drag. Ineos says the electric car had been altered so its cruise management is extra accurate than that of normal fashions.
